What they do
A Dental Assistant assists dentists in caring for patient's teeth. Helps patients get ready for treatment; prepares equipment and supplies. May perform some dental procedures under the direction of a dentist, such as fluoride application, if allowed under state regulations. Works in dental offices.

Orthodontic Dental Assistant Castro Valley Orthodontics - 4.4 Castro Valley, CA Job Details Full-time $20 - $35 an hour 7 hours ago Benefits Health insurance 401(k) Paid time off Employee discount Retirement plan Qualifications Customer communication Preparing dental treatment areas Dental instrument processing Patient service Attention to detail Full Job Description We are a growing orthodontic practice looking for a friendly, energetic, customer service focused individual to join our team. A qualified candidate should have the following: Enjoy working in a face-paced environment Works well independently and with a team Great communication skills Hard working and can multitask Enjoys working with children, teens and adults Excellent fine-motor skills and attention to detail Self-directed and motivated Assist the orthodontist with patient care and treatment Prepare and maintain dental instruments, supplies, and equipment Take x-rays, impressions, digital scans, and photographs Accurately document procedures and treatment notes Provide post-treatment instructions and communication to patients
